Python onnxruntime模块1.15.0版本发布

版权申诉
0 下载量 151 浏览量 更新于2024-10-29 收藏 6.5MB ZIP 举报
资源摘要信息:"ONNX Runtime(ONNX Runtime官方简称onnxruntime)是微软和Facebook合作开发的一种性能优化的深度学习推理引擎,它支持ONNX(Open Neural Network Exchange)格式。ONNX是一种开放式的模型格式标准,用于AI模型的交换,允许开发者在不同的深度学习框架(如PyTorch、TensorFlow等)之间转换和共享模型。onnxruntime-1.15.0-cp311-cp311-linux_armv7l.whl.zip文件为针对Python 3.11版本在ARM v7架构的Linux操作系统上编译的ONNX Runtime软件包的压缩文件,包含了Wheel(.whl)格式的安装包和使用说明文档。 Wheel(.whl)格式是由PEP 427提出的一种Python分发包格式,它是一种预先构建的二进制分发包,用于Python包的安装,能够加快安装速度,因为它减少了构建过程中的步骤,尤其是在复杂的构建环境中。该格式在2012年被提议,旨在作为替代现有的egg格式的更优解决方案。Wheel包安装简单快捷,只需通过pip工具进行安装即可。 文件中的onnxruntime-1.15.0-cp311-cp311-linux_armv7l.whl文件是适用于Python 3.11版本的onnxruntime模块的wheel包,专为基于ARM v7架构的Linux操作系统设计。ARM v7架构广泛应用于嵌入式系统和移动设备中,这使得onnxruntime能够在这些领域内运行。文件名中的'cp311'指的是CPython 3.11版本的实现,CPython是Python语言的一种标准实现。 该文件包对于需要在资源受限或嵌入式设备上部署模型的开发者特别重要,因为ONNX Runtime支持模型的高效执行。它支持广泛的神经网络操作,并且在性能优化方面进行了大量工作,使其成为工业界和学术界广泛接受的一种模型部署工具。 开发者可以通过查看压缩包中的使用说明.txt文件获取安装指南和使用详情。一般情况下,安装过程包括解压文件,然后使用pip安装命令将whl文件安装到Python环境中。例如,可以在命令行中使用以下命令: ```bash pip install onnxruntime-1.15.0-cp311-cp311-linux_armv7l.whl ``` 确保在执行安装命令之前,文件已解压到当前目录下,并且当前用户具备安装权限。如果在安装过程中遇到任何问题,可以参照使用说明文档中的内容寻求解决方案或进一步的指导。 总结起来,onnxruntime-1.15.0-cp311-cp311-linux_armv7l.whl.zip文件是专门为ARM v7架构的Linux操作系统编译的ONNX Runtime的Python模块安装包,它通过Wheel格式简化了安装流程,并且适合在资源有限的设备上部署和运行AI模型。"